Output 164a18241408b2ffa6fecaf13d0856a518d0b2754dadf4355d3d63dfcda5b749:11

value
590292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16f3267cd80a082dd87a2ea5b77d47c343cbf66 OP_EQUAL
address
3HsCjbNwxTLakgLUGCQ7XhFzBpQFnYASbn
transaction
164a18241408b2ffa6fecaf13d0856a518d0b2754dadf4355d3d63dfcda5b749